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55292784579 50165532 552160934 64989994
061 112229 744840606
061 112229 744840606
351895 259 5832 6851318
All about undefined
Interested in learning more?
061 112229 744840606
351895 259 5832 6851318
See more
454927201 4780 22
3383592820 620447657 2477480 97
See more
59963692868 3349124396 10156221405
1737 87067 70893623
See more